Contaminated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single room Yes No You can likely handle a small leak on your own, but be sure to act quickly to reduce damage.
Burst pipe in a multi-room area No Yes A burst pipe in a multi-room area need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es A flooded basement with standing water needs professional equipment and expertise to remove safely and efficiently.
Hidden water damage behind walls or under floors No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and remove safely and efficiently.
Large-scale flood with extensive damage No Yes A large-scale flood with extensive damage needs professional attention to ensure a safe environment and reduce downtime.
Water damage in a historic or antique home No Yes Water damage in a historic or antique home needs specialized expertise to preserve the integrity of the structure and its contents.

Contaminated Water Removal Cost in Justin, TX

The cost of Contaminated Water Removal in Justin, TX, varies based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and may not reflect your specific situation. Contact us for a free on-site assessment and qu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local conditions
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local conditions
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local conditions
Disinfection and Deodorization $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of flooring
Equipment Rental and Labor $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
